Dre P.’s undulating versatility is not just constricted to music and but his accomplishments are defined as an actor too. He was featured in 2 Pac’s celebrated biopic ‘All Eyez On Me’ that only added to his unending trajectory of multifaceted flairs. Dre P. sometimes goes by the name ‘Mud City’ or ‘The Mudd’, which in other words, is a symbolic tribute to the baseball team Toledo Mud Hens. Based out of Atlanta and working under the label name of Fly Guy Entertainment Co., he also divulged his repping experience for Big brother Detroit or ‘The D’ with great success. Along with spreading his mellifluous musical tributes, he has also lent his hands in formulating his own clothing line, ‘Mud City’.

Dre P.’s career graph constitutes innumerable hits including ‘Where She At’, ‘Tellin Lies’, and ‘Sauce’ among others and plentiful of albums, singles, and EP’s to his name.
